***Thunderstorms imply gusty and erratic winds      ***
***Winds are 20 foot 10-minute averages             ***
***CWR: Chance of wetting rain 0.10 or greater      ***
***Ventilation Index is derived from transport wind
   multiplied by the mixing height in 100`s of ft.
   Categories are a generalized indicator only:
   low (< 200), moderate (200-500), high (500-700),
   and very high (> 700).                           ***

.DISCUSSION...Dry conditions prevail with sustained winds of
around 5 to 15 mph with a small chance (5 to 15 percent) of
seeing a brief 20 mph gust, especially tonight.  Overall,
winds will be coming from the west before shifting more towards
the north on Monday. Relative humidity levels will be in the
teens today and tomorrow, with good overnight recoveries
in the 50s and 60s.
